Advertisement

C语言程序设计第五版实例源代码RAR

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源包含《C语言程序设计》第五版教材中的所有实例源代码,适用于学习和实践C语言编程。 《C语言程序设计(第五版)》由宋广军主编,谭小球、陈荣品、张建科、侯志凌担任副主编。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• CRAR
    优质
    本资源包含《C语言程序设计》第五版教材中的所有实例源代码,适用于学习和实践C语言编程。 《C语言程序设计(第五版)》由宋广军主编,谭小球、陈荣品、张建科、侯志凌担任副主编。
  • C习题解答.rar
    优质
    《C语言程序设计第五版习题解答》提供了教材中各章节练习题的详细解析和答案,帮助学习者巩固知识、提高编程技能。 《C语言程序设计(第五版)》是高等学校计算机应用规划教材中的经典著作之一,由宋广军主编,并有谭小球、陈荣品、张建科及侯志凌等副主编的参与。该书以深入浅出的方式介绍了C语言的基础知识、编程技巧以及实际应用场景,旨在帮助学生和程序员掌握C语言的核心概念和技术。 作为第五版,《C语言程序设计(第五版)》在前几版的基础上进行了更新与改进,以便更好地适应现代编程环境的变化需求。本书详细讲解了以下关键知识点: 1. **基本语法**:涵盖变量、数据类型(如int, char, float等)、运算符(包括算术、比较和逻辑运算符)、流程控制语句(if语句、switch语句及for循环与while循环)。 2. **函数**:C语言中的函数是代码模块化的重要工具,书中详细讲解了定义、调用函数的方法以及参数传递和返回值的概念。 3. **指针**:作为C语言的一大特色,读者将学习如何声明、初始化和操作指针,并理解其与数组及函数的关系。 4. **内存管理**:包括动态内存分配(如malloc, calloc, realloc, free)及其使用技巧以及避免内存泄漏的方法。 5. **结构体与联合体**:通过这些C语言的数据类型,可以组合不同类型的变量为一个整体单元进行操作和处理。 6. **预处理器指令**:例如宏定义、头文件包含等内容,帮助理解在程序编译前阶段的作用。 7. **文件操作**:学习如何打开、读取、写入及关闭文件的操作方法以及实现数据的持久化存储功能。 8. **错误处理机制**:掌握使用errno和perror来识别并解决运行时出现的问题的方法。 9. **标准库函数的应用**:了解常用的数学运算、字符串操作与输入输出等标准库函数的功能及其正确使用方式。 10. **编译与调试技巧**:学习如何利用GCC这样的编译器进行C程序的编译过程,以及通过GDB等工具来进行有效的代码调试工作。 书中还附有习题答案文档《习题答案.doc》,为读者提供了练习题目的解答参考,有助于检验个人的理解和应用能力,并进一步巩固所学知识。通过解决这些题目,可以提升编程技能并逐步掌握C语言的实际编程技巧。 总之,《C语言程序设计(第五版)》是一本全面且详尽的教材,无论是初学者还是有经验的开发者都能从中受益匪浅。通过对该书的学习和实践应用,读者将能够编写出高效可靠的C语言程序,并为学习其他高级编程语言打下坚实的基础。
  • C)谭浩强 课件及.zip
    优质
    本资源包包含《C语言程序设计》(第五版)由谭浩强编著的配套课件与全部源代码,适用于学习和教学使用。 谭浩强老师的《C程序设计第5版》的课件和程序源代码包括10章内容,且文件无需解压缩密码即可使用。
  • C子棋(课).rar
    优质
    这段资源为一个使用C语言编写的五子棋游戏源代码,适用于课程设计项目。该程序实现了基本的游戏规则和人机对战功能。 C 语言项目包含完整源码。该项目适合课程设计使用,功能完善、界面美观、操作简单且管理便捷,非常适合新手学习与练习。 技术组成: - 开发语言:C 语言 - 开发环境:Visual Studio / Visual C++ 6.0
  • C)习题.rar
    优质
    《C语言程序设计(第三版)》配套习题解答与源代码资源包,包含书中所有练习题目的参考答案及完整编程示例,有助于加深对课程内容的理解和掌握。 该文件包含了浙江大学出版的《C语言程序设计(第3版)》教材中所有出现在PTA网站上的编程类练习题和课后习题的源程序。
  • C#Windows()_
    优质
    本书《C#语言Windows程序设计(第二版)》的配套实验代码集,旨在通过实践加深读者对书本知识的理解与掌握。 强调“教与学面对面”的教学方式,主体内容衔接合理顺畅,技术要点逐层深入解析,示例分析图文并茂、代码注释详尽明晰。 书中设有多个小栏目帮助读者轻松学习:难点问题随时提供详细解释,“提示”重点知识,并设置“扩展学习”板块以提升技术水平。重视实战应用,学以致用,在视频应用、图像处理以及邮件接发三大应用程序的实战设计过程中指导读者独立开发出一些简单实用的Windows应用程序。
  • C详解
    优质
    《C语言详解第五版》配套源代码提供了书中示例程序的完整代码实现,方便读者对照学习和实践。 《C语言详解(第五版)》,原书名为Problem Solving and Programming in C, Fifth Edition,是一本经典的C语言教材,已由人民邮电出版社出版。这是该书的源代码版本。
  • C)-谭浩强.ppt
    优质
    《C语言程序设计(第五版)》由著名计算机教育专家谭浩强教授编著,本书深入浅出地介绍了C语言的基本概念、语法结构及编程技巧,适合初学者和中级程序员使用。 C 语言程序设计第五版 本资源涵盖了 C 语言程序设计的教学大纲及课时安排,包括教材、参考书目、学习要点等内容。 ### C 语言的发展历史 C 语言的起源可以追溯到1972年,在美国贝尔实验室,Ken Thompson和Dennis Ritchie共同开发了这门编程语言。初衷是为了编写UNIX操作系统。之后,经过多个发展阶段,如ALGOL60、BCPL及B语言等。直到1978年,Brian Kernighan与Dennis Ritchie合著的《The C Programming Language》出版后,C 语言才确立了其标准地位。随后在1983年和1987年经历了两次重要的修订,并于1990年正式成为国际标准ANSI C。 ### C 语言的特点 C 语言具有以下显著特点: - 简洁、紧凑且灵活的语言风格 - 多样化的运算符支持 - 强大的数据结构(如链表,树和栈)以及丰富的数据类型 - 结构化及模块化的程序设计方法 - 较为宽松的语法规定赋予了程序员更高的自由度 - 提供访问内存地址的能力,并能执行位操作 - 生成高质量的目标代码 - 良好的可移植性 ### C 语言的关键字 C 语言共有32个关键字,具体如下: auto, break, case, char, const, continue, default, do, double, else, enum, extern, float, for, goto, if , int , long , register , return , short signed , sizeof , static struct , switch , typedef unsigned union void volatile while ### 课程安排 本课程共计64学时,旨在使学生掌握C语言的基础概念、熟悉Turbo C的上机操作环境,并能阅读编写和调试程序。主要内容包括: - 掌握C语言的基本理论知识; - 熟练使用Turbo C进行编程实践; - 能够独立完成算法分析与设计任务。 ### 学习要求 为了取得良好的学习效果,建议学生做到以下几点: - 课前认真预习相关章节内容。 - 上课时保持安静专注的状态以确保高效的学习氛围。 - 按照规定时间和质量提交作业,并保证其原创性及独立完成度; - 加强实践操作,在宝贵的上机时间内提高编程技巧。
  • C)谭浩强著 PPT
    优质
    《C语言程序设计(第五版)》由著名计算机教育专家谭浩强教授编写,该书PPT内容全面覆盖了C语言的基本语法和编程技巧,适合初学者系统学习。 本课件包含十章内容,并参考了中国高等院校计算机基础教育课程体系规划教材的内容。它采用图文结合的方式,便于读者理解和学习。
  • C六章习题解答
    优质
    《C语言程序设计(第五版)》第六章习题解答为学习者提供了详细的解题思路和代码实现,帮助读者深入理解和掌握C语言的核心概念与编程技巧。 谭浩强第五版的《C程序设计》课后习题答案(第六章),由于无法扫描文件,我拍了高清图片上传。考虑到制作成PDF可能不清晰,所以使用原图发布,需要的朋友可以下载后续章节的内容我会每天更新一章节。